McAlester is a city in Pittsburg County, Oklahoma, United States. The population was 17,783 at the 2000 census. It is the county seat of Pittsburg County It is currently the largest city in the Choctaw Nation of Oklahoma, followed by Durant.
It is also the location of the headquarters of the International Order of the Rainbow for Girls.
McAlester was the site of the 2004 trial of Terry Nichols on Oklahoma state charges related to the Oklahoma City bombing (1995).
